HMT: The Science & Application of Heat and Mass Transfer: Reports, Reviews & Computer Programs, Volume 2: Flow, Mixing and Heat Transfer in Furnaces is a collection of papers from the First Conference on Mechanical Power Engineering. The title presents experimental and theoretical research in the field of flow, mixing, and heat transfer in furnaces. The experimental papers in the selection include the effect of the exit section geometry and furnace length on mixing in a cold model industrial furnace, as well as the effect of some parameters on the characteristics of heat liberated along a cylindrical reversed flow furnace. The theoretical papers tackle topics such as study of mixing of two coaxial swirling jets in a cold model furnace and numerical computations of turbulent swirling flames in axisymmetric combustors. The book will be of great use to students, researchers, and practitioners of mechanical engineering.

Numerical Prediction of Flow, Heat Transfer, Turbulence and Combustion: Selected Works of Professor D. Brian Spalding focuses on the many contributions of Professor Spalding on thermodynamics. This compilation of his works is done to honor the professor on the occasion of his 60th birthday. Relatively, the works contained in this book are selected to highlight the genius of Professor Spalding in this field of interest. The book presents various research on combustion, heat transfer, turbulence, and flows. His thinking on separated flows paved the way for the multi-dimensional modeling of turbulence. Arguments on the universality of the models of turbulence and the problems that are associated with combustion engineering are clarified. The text notes the importance of combustion science as well as the problems associated with it. Mathematical computations are also presented in determining turbulent flows in different environments, including on curved pipes, curved ducts, and rotating ducts. These calculations are presented to further strengthen the claims of Professor Spalding in this discipline. The book is a great find for those who are interested in studying thermodynamics.

Turbulence in Mixing Operations: Theory and Application to Mixing and Reaction presents a summary of the current status of research on turbulent motion, mixing, and kinetics. Each chapter of this book discusses turbulence in the context of mixing and reaction in scalar fields. Chapters I and III discuss the classification of turbulent reacting systems and the different possibilities in this context. Chapter II reviews the properties of passive mixing. Chapter IV looks at turbulent mixing in chemically reactive flows. Chapter V uses different techniques to make parallel numerical calculations of both mixing and reaction. Finally, Chapter VI reviews turbulence and actual industrial mixing operations. This book will be of great value for chemical and industrial engineers, especially for those interested in turbulent and industrial mixing.
